John Smith and Co. have big recruiting weekend:
There are a lot of natural ties between the Cowboys and a number of the top guys in this 2021 class. If OSU can land a few of them, coupled with what they have coming in already for 2020, watch out! What the Cowboys have for 2020 should compete for NCAA titles. A few more of these guys for 2021 and they’ll be loaded with stars up and down the lineup unlike anything we’ve seen at OSU in years.
2020 commits Dustin Plott, Luke Surber, and Konner Doucet were also in attendance. {PFB}

Mason Cox makes an appearance on SportsCenter:
Oklahoma State’s own Mason Cox got to head back to his home town of Dallas, Texas from Australia to cover the Cowboys/ Eagles Sunday Night Football game.
